Yeah, you're right, I don't think he'll suit the diamond. He has to be played wide out on the left for him to be most effective.

I have no idea what formation we'll be playing next season. I guess it depends what players we can get. I'd like to see us revert to a 4-4-2. But we'll need 2 strong running centre midfielders and 2 hard working wingers. It's hard to say whether John will be able to cement himself into the team as a first choice winger as he doesn't do enough of the dirty work. Our front men in Kermorgant, Cox and Rakels, they certainly won't be defending from the front the way Doyle, Kitson and Long used to.

Just gonna throw it out here that the 'supposed promotion front runners and proud historic giants of the Championship' Sheffield Wednesday signed their top man Lucas João for around £2m. 'Forces-to-be-reckoned-with-come-title-favourites' Derby County signed Abdoul(lol) Camara for £2m and Nick Blackman for £3m.

My point being that if we want to mix it wiht the 'big boys' then £3m is what we need to be spending. Ola John has done enough for me to show he could be worth that fee.
